Walter. OTATE OF MICHIGAN, COÜNTY OF ' Washtenaw, es. At a eepsion of the Probate Court for theCountyot Washtenaw, holden at the Probate office in the City of Ann Arbor, on Tuesday, the 19th day of July, in the year one thousand eight hundred and ninety-eight. Present, H. Wlrt Newkirk, Judge of Probate. In ithe matter of the estáte of Edward L. Walter, deceased. On reading and flling the petltion duly verifled, of Mary Francés Isom. praying thata certain instrument now on file In this Court, purporting to be the last will and testament of said deceased, may be admitted to probate and that admlnistration of said estáte may be granted to Walter P. Sherman and Harry O. Crane, the executors in said will named, or to some other suitable person. Thereupon it is ordered that Friday, the 19th day of August next, at 10 o'clock in the forenoon, be assigned for the hearing of said petition, and that the devisees, legatees and heire at law of said deceased and all other persons interested in said estáte, are required to appear at a sesslon of said Court, then to be holden at the Probate Office, in the City of Ann Arbor, and show cause if any there be, why the prayer of the petitloner should not be granted. And It is further ordered that said petitioner frive notice to the persons interested in said estáte, of the pendency of said petition, and the hearing thereof, by causing a copy of this order to be published in the Ann Arbor Argus, a newspaper printed and clroulated in said oounty three sucees6ive weeks previous to said day of hearing. H. WIRT NBWKIRK, Judge of Probate. [A true copy.J P. J.
